The Data and Platform Engineering team are the foundation for the Data Office function. Responsible for designing, building, and maintaining PfP's data platform we extract data from source, transform it into a usable format, load it into consumer models and marts and build and manage the infrastructure to do all this work.
Data Engineering are transforming the way PfP consumes data. Having transitioned from On Premise to Google Cloud we are in the process of building a leading-edge Data Mesh platform. This is an exciting time to join a growing business function, with the opportunity to make your mark defining the architecture of the data platform and the continued development of the data engineering function.
The Role of the Data Architect:
- The Data Architect occupies a pivotal position within our data engineering team, driving both strategic and enabling initiatives.
- This individual is instrumental in ensuring that our data platform supports decentralisation, in line with data mesh principles.
- Furthermore, the Data Architect guarantees that our data products are interoperable, well-governed, and consistently aligned with both enterprise standards and the overarching data platform.
Data Platform Architecture Design:
- Overseeing the comprehensive design of the data platform's architecture, ensuring it meets current and future needs.
- Producing clear, detailed architectural documentation and diagrams to facilitate understanding and implementation.
- Embedding a domain-oriented ownership model and fostering a Data as a Product (DaP) mindset across all development efforts.
- Designing solutions that uphold governance, security, and quality requirements.
Data Product Design Standards:
- Ensuring that data products are discoverable, interoperable, and trustworthy, adhering to high standards.
Data Pipeline Design:
- Designing robust data pipelines, including batch, event-driven, and streaming architectures.
Operational Considerations:
- Addressing operational concerns such as security, scalability, performance, observability, and user experience.
The Data Architect works closely and collaboratively with the Principal Data Platform Engineer and the Principal Data Engineer to architect and develop the data platform. In this capacity, the Data Architect acts as a trusted advisor on data strategy and platform direction, providing valuable input on data capabilities and trade-offs, and making significant contributions to the development of the data roadmap.
In addition, the Data Architect partners with domain squads, assisting them in designing robust data products and providing architectural designs and technical guidance. The role also encompasses the mentorship of engineers and analysts in areas such as data modelling, integration, and design best practices, thus strengthening the overall technical capability of the team.
